Price of a hardware wallet vs a software wallet

A hardware wallet is a device that stores the private keys for your crypto coins offline. They are easy to set up and offer better security than software wallets.

Software wallets are easier to use, but they can be hacked. There is also the chance that your private key will be stolen when it is unlocked.

The best hardware wallets are designed to protect your digital assets against physical attacks. Popular brands like TREZOR and Ledger use robust technology and a secure element to make sure that your private key is kept safe.

If you don’t use your private keys often, a software wallet may be a better choice. The advantages of a software wallet include the ability to access your funds anywhere, and the option to store the keys online. However, it is still important to back up your information.

A hardware wallet is more expensive than a software wallet, but it is worth it for the increased security it offers. Hardware wallets are also more durable. It is difficult to infect a hardware wallet with malware, and they are virtually impenetrable to hackers.
